Overview Bluflox OZ Dry Syrup
Pediatric patients suffering from diverse bacterial infections affecting the teeth, lungs, gastrointestinal system, or urinary and genital tracts may benefit from the antibiotic, Bluflox OZ Dry Syrup. Administer this oral medication to your child at the same time each day, ideally either before or after meals; if stomach upset occurs, administer with food. The typical dosage is twice daily, once in the morning and once in the evening. Should vomiting occur within 30 minutes of administration, repeat the dose; however, avoid doubling the dose if the next scheduled dose is imminent. Adhere strictly to the prescribed dosage, timing, and method as determined by your physician; these are tailored to the infection's nature and severity, your child's age, and weight. While minor, transient side effects such as nausea, vomiting, metallic taste, headache, appetite loss, abdominal discomfort, and mild rash may appear, they usually subside as your child adjusts to the medication. Persistent or bothersome side effects warrant immediate consultation with your pediatrician. Prior to treatment, inform your doctor of any history of allergies, heart conditions, liver problems, or kidney dysfunction. A complete medical history is essential for optimal dosage and treatment planning.

How to use Bluflox OZ Dry Syrup:
Administer this medication precisely as your physician directs, adhering to the prescribed dosage and treatment schedule. Consult the product label for detailed instructions prior to use. The powder should be completely dissolved in sterile water. Ensure thorough mixing before consumption. Bluflox OZ Dry Syrup can be ingested with or without food; however, consistent daily timing is recommended.

SAFETY ADVICE
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Bluflox OZ Dry Syrup. Dosage modifications may be necessary. Physician consultation is recommended.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should use Bluflox OZ Dry Syrup judiciously; d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is recommended.
What if you forget to take Bluflox OZ Dry Syrup :
Remain calm. Administer the medication upon recollection, unless your pediatrician has prescribed a different schedule. If uncertain, contact your doctor; avoid doubling the dose to compensate for a missed one.
